The gecko is a type of lizard found in different parts of the world, especially in tropical and subtropical climates. Although the gecko is not generally associated with specific cultural or religious symbols, it can have different meanings depending on cultural or personal context. Here are some of the common meanings or interpretations associated with the gecko:

  1. Luck and Protection : In some cultures, geckos are considered symbols of luck and protection. Their presence is sometimes said to bring good fortune, and they are sometimes seen as guardians of the house.

  2. Adaptability and agility : Geckos are known for their ability to adapt to different environments and climb various surfaces using their adhesive legs. As a result, they can be interpreted as symbols of adaptability, agility and flexibility.

  3. Regeneration and renewal : Some geckos have the ability to regenerate their tail if lost, which can be seen as a symbol of renewal and regeneration.

  4. Energy and Vitality : Geckos are often associated with a vivacious energy due to their active behavior at night. In some cultures this can be interpreted as a symbol of energy and vitality.

  5. Pet : In some parts of the world, geckos are kept as pets, which can symbolize a love of animals or appreciation of the beauty of nature.

  6. Respect for nature : The gecko, as a species of lizard, can also symbolize respect for nature and biodiversity. Its presence often reminds us of the diversity of animal species in the world.

  7. Tattoos and Art : The gecko is sometimes chosen as a tattoo or art design, especially by those who appreciate its distinctive shape and bright colors.

The meaning of gecko can vary from culture to culture and often depends on personal beliefs and interpretations. Some people may attribute particular meanings to the gecko based on their experience or culture.
